Suraj Subhash Shinde was a 19-year-old student in Maharashtra.

He was studying for the NEET exam to try to enter medical college.

His family found him dead in an upstairs room at home.

Police were reportedly considering suicide as the cause of death.

Suraj left a short note for his parents.

The note said he was sorry and hoped to become a doctor for them in another life.

The article says study and future-related stress may have contributed to his death.

It also mentions controversy over alleged NEET paper leaks and efforts to improve the exam system.
